Rabu, 15 Mei 2013

Membuat Mesin pencari berbasis PHP dan MySQL dengan sphider

Leave a Comment
Pernah terbayang ,membuat search engine layaknya google,yahoo atau bing?
tapi males berpusing-pusing ria?
Memang untuk membuat suatu search engine tidaklah mudah, dikarenakan algoritma yang rumit.
Search engine sendiri dibagi menjadi beberapa bagian sebagai berikut:
  1. Crawler
  2. Indexer
  3. Search Engine
Apa itu crawler? 

crawler atau sering disebut bot,robot,atau sphider adalah sebuah mesin yang bekerja mengumpulkan informasi dari website yang ia kunjungi.
Setelah data terkumpul oleh crawler kemudian indexer bekerja menyusun data kedalam database agar mempermudah search engine dalam pengumpulan data.

Dalam proses pencarian, search engine menempuh proses information retrieval yang sangat panjang namun berlangsung dengan sangat cepat.

tapi tidak usah khawatir, sekarang telah ada banyak sekali project open source termasuk search engine
salah satunya sphider, dan ini ling downloadnya download sphider.
Selamat mencoba :)

0 komentar:

Posting Komentar